Copper Steadies Near Record as Trump Rejects Iran’s Peace Plan

Why This Matters

Copper prices hold near record highs as geopolitical tensions escalate following Trump's rejection of Iran's peace plan, suggesting continued supply chain uncertainty. This development may support copper's price due to potential disruptions in global markets. The situation could lead to increased volatility in commodities and related assets.

Market Impact

The rejection of Iran's peace plan may lead to increased geopolitical risk, supporting copper prices near record highs. This could have a positive impact on copper-related assets, such as mining stocks, while potentially pressuring assets sensitive to global economic uncertainty.

Copper steadied near its highest close on record after US President Donald Trump dismissed Iran’s proposals for a peace deal and said the ceasefire with Tehran was on “life support”.
